Archiving (storing) titles on a
DVD+RW/+R
You can choose the title of the HDD that you want to transfer on a
DVD+RW/+R. The copying process is done at a higher speed than the
recording. Therefore, you can transfer an 8-hour recording in '
M8
'
recording mode on a DVD+RW/+R in just 30 minutes. This time
depends on the recording mode used.
Please observe the following information:
•)
You cannot change the recording quality. You can only use the same
recording quality that was used for recording on the HDD.
•)
New recordings will always be added at the end of existing ones.
Ensure that the '
Empty title
' after the last recording is large
enough.
•)
The index picture from the title will be copied from the HDD and
stored on the disc.
•)
Should you reach the maximum number of chapters per disc (255),
the archiving will be stopped.
•)
The following information will also be stored on the disc in the
process:
Chapter, recording mode, programme name (if available) title of the
recording (name), date and time of the recording, index picture.
•)
If you archive the edited title (Symbol '
A
'), the 'hidden' chapters will
be skipped and not copied to the DVD+RW/+R.

Finalising a DVD+R
If recordings were stored (archived) on a DVD+R you have to finalise it
to make play back in a DVD-Player possible.
- Press
DISC MENU
and then
STOP
h
to mark the first title.
- Press
A
to go to the 'disc info screen'
- Press
C
and select then the line '
Finalise disc
' using
B
.
- Confirn with
OK
.
